* [hip-tests] Update API coverage report generator Updates the HIP API coverage tool. It now takes extra arguments for the location of the catch test folder and for the working directory. This avoids issues where the output of the executable is dependent on the path where it is being executed from. Also updates CmakeLists.txt to integrate seamlessly with the hip-tests project and avoid using commands which rely on relative paths. * Remove double new line * Remove Cmake option to generate coverage Removes Cmake option to generate coverage. Instead, explicitly removes the gen_coverage target from all (this is already the default but doing it explicitly prevents confusion).
